ABOUT

TITLE

Same Same

LOGLINE

Meeting through a social networking app, three women from very different backgrounds navigate life, love and the complexities of the

modern queer experience.

SYNOPSIS

Same Same is the story of Emily, Aviva & Sam, three queer girls figuring out how to live their lives under the changing timetable for adulthood. Aviva just came out in her mid-twenties, but doesn't know a single lesbian. Sam’s big mouth is always working against her, and Emily has already slept with half of Brooklyn,

rendering her pool of choice miniscule. Once they connect through an app called SameSame, these girls will laugh, lie and do whatever it takes to help

each other navigate life in this upbeat, semi-improvised dramedy about feelings, friendship and sex.

RUNTIMES

Episode 101 : Pilot : 8.39

Episode 102 : Back At The Bar : 7.17

Episode 103 : Got A Match! Aviva & Toshi : 3.55

Episode 104 : A Little 101 : 6.21

Episode 105 : Got A Match! Yasmina & Uncle Meg : 4.43

Episode 106 : Fluid : 6.21

Episode 107 : Got A Match! Sam & Maya : 3.45

Episode 108 : Brunch : 5.26

Episode 109 : Got A Match! Caitlin & Indie : 3.00

Episode 110 : Fifty Shades of Literature : 6.22

Episode 111 : Got A Match! Eloise & Luna : 4.21

Episode 112 : Loose Ends : 6.05

Total Run Time: 1:06:15

TEAM

Stephanie Begg / Writer, Director, Producer Stephanie is an Australian born director, writer, producer and actor. Her first short film  Fighting for Mable, which explored eating disorders and body image issues for young women,  toured Australia with the  2005 Reel Life Film Festival. She recently adapted & directed the short film  An Empty House with Many Doors, from the story by Hugo and Nebula award winning author Michael Swanwick. In 2014 she wrote the short film  Opal, directed by her partner Josh Mawer, and produced the shorts  Gone  (2010) and  Reprieve  (2013). In 2008 she wrote and directed  The Shack, about a woman dealing with the ghosts of her childhood and abusive father, damaged by his experience in World War II. She lent her hand to writing and directing comedy sketches on the series  Sketchmen  (channel TVS) and directed a run of Arabian Nights New Theatre) in Sydney, Australia.

Lauren Augarten / Creator Lauren Augarten is a writer, director and producer. Her recent writing credits include RSVP, a short film that screened at the Atlantic Film Festival in Canada, and won Best Comedy Short at the Queens World Film. Lauren recently produced The Disgustings, a short film that was an official selection of Outfest, Newfest and Frameline. Lauren created the web series Same Same based on her experiences as a newly out lesbian in Brooklyn, NY, the pilot of which won the LGBT Category award at the LA New Media Film Festival, and was official selection at Newfest. It has been featured in the Huffington Post, Washington Post and GLAAD. She wrote her first play Define You at fifteen. It was published by Australia’s largest performing arts publisher, Currency Press.

TEAM

April Maxey / Writer April Maxey is a San Antonio, Texas native who graduated from Pratt Institute in Brooklyn, NY with a BFA in Film/Video. Her writing & directing credits include three short films; Girl Scouting, Polaroid Girl, and This Is You And Me, which have collectively screened at 45 festivals and won 6 awards. The screenplay for This Is You And Me, which she co-wrote with Summer Czajak, was 1 of 9 projects in the Berlinale Talents Short Film Station in 2015. Her latest music video for Miss Eaves, Thunder Thighs, recently went viral with over 1 million views on youtube.

Josh Mawer / Director, Producer Josh Mawer  is a director and editor with over a decade in film and commercial production experience in Australia and the USA.   Josh co-wrote and directed the short films  Legacy  and  Opal during prostgraduate studies at the prestigious AFTRS, Australia.  Legacy  won Best Director at  North Wales International, an ACS Bronze and was nominated for the  National Irish Science Fiction Film Awards. His short  Gone  was funded through Metroscreen's First Breaks grant and his film  Blood Type  won Best Director in the Sydney 48hr Film Festival.  Josh holds a Graduate Diploma in Narrative Directing  from the Australian Film, Television & Radio School  (AFTRS).

CAST

Kelly Sebastian / Emily Actress Kelly Sebastian has graced the cover of Go Magazine and was featured in their 100 Women We Love. She recently played the role of Liza opposite Naomi Watts on Netflix’s Gypsy. You can also catch her as the brand voice for ALT NATION on Sirius/XM. Her directorial debut A Girl And A Goldfish was part of the collection ‘Best Lesbian & Alternative Short Films’ that screened at LGBT Centers nationally.

Lauren Augarten / Aviva Lauren Augarten, a graduate of David Mamet’s Atlantic Theater School, has appeared on stage & screen in New York and Los Angeles as well as her native home, Australia. You can catch her in Mara Leseman’s Surviving Family, currently on iTunes, as well as Ryan Moulton’s Maybe Someday opposite UnREAL’s Kim Matula, and Daniel Maldonado's H.O.M.E, produced by Darren Dean (Tangerine, The Florida Project).

Alisha B. Woods / Sam Alisha is a standup comedian who has graced the great New York stages, including stints at Gotham Comedy Club, New York Comedy Club, Greenwich Village Comedy Club and Broadway Comedy Club.

Stephanie Begg / Caitlin Stephanie is an actor with both classical theatre training in Australia and the USA (Atlantic Theatre Company), and improvisational comedy with UCB in New York. She has appeared on the Australian TV series  Let's Talk About  (Foxtel), Wild Boys  (Seven Network), Framed By War (ABC) and in the feature film  Chained. She performed onstage in Mother Clap's Molly House for the 2015 Sydney Gay & Lesbian Mardi Gras Festival, and was critically acclaimed for her portrayal of Mary Warren in Arthur Miller’s  The Crucible and Cecily in Oscar Wilde’s The Importance of Being Ernest.

Holly Curran / Eloise Holly Curran is a proud graduate of NYU Tisch's drama program, studying at the Lee Strasberg Theater and Film Institute, the Classical Studio, and Stonestreet Studios. She made her broadway debut understudying in the Tony award winning play A View from the Bridge, and can be seen this December in the new series The Marvelous Mrs. Maisel (Amazon). Previous credits include Bull (CBS), Chicago Justice (NBC) and Z: the Beginning of Everything (Amazon).

CASTCarmen Lobue / Yasmina Carmen Lobue has graced the stages of New York in Harry & The Thief (Habitat Theatre) and Lords Resistance (Obie award winning, The Fire This Time Festival). Carmen recently starred in the short film What Came After directed by Tony Award winner Tonya Pinkins, written by Christopher Oscar Pena (Insecure).   Other credits include Pink & Baby Blue (Slamdance) and Splinters (Miami Gay & Lesbian Film Festival)  

Daniel Thompson / Mikey Daniel is from Petaluma, CA. A graduate of David Mamet’s Atlantic Theatre School, he has honed his skills in New York City over the last six years. His first bartending job was at The Immigrant Wine before moving on to Craft Cocktails in Chinatown and is now the head bartender at Nitehawk Cinema in Brooklyn. What - you thought all those bartending skills were from research?

Jamie Clayton / Niamh Jamie Clayton can currently be seen starring as ‘Nomi Marks’ in the Wachowski’s series Sense 8 (Netflix). Jamie’s breakthrough role was playing Kyla on the hit HBO series Hung. Her work also secured her a place as one of OUT Magazine’s 100 honorees for 2011. She then went on to star in the Emmy Award winning web series, Dirty Work, as well as The Neon Demon (Nicolas Winding Refn), BoJack Horseman (Netflix) and recently The Snowman (Tomas Alfredson). As a model, Jamie has been shot by some of the world’s leading photographers and has been featured in national campaigns for Jeremy Scott and Obsessive Compulsive Cosmetics.

Paulina Singer / Aimee Paulina Singer is a New York based actress and artist, who got her start on HBO’s How to Make it in America, playing the recurring role of Nilda, a young lesbian struggling to come out to a mother who won’t accept her. She went on to star in We TV’s South of Hell, and can be seen on The Affair (Showtime), Dead of Summer (Freeform), Orange is the New Black (Netflix) and Gotham (Fox).

CAST

Margaret Reed - Annie Margaret Reed grew up in Salinas, California before entering the University of California at Santa Cruz where she earned her B.A. in Theatre Arts. Margaret then was awarded her M.F.A. from Cornell University. She then toured the U.S. in John Houseman's The Acting Company, playing many different classical heroines. Some of her most notable TV roles were Shannon O'Hara McKechnie on As the World Turns (8 years), Mary Contardi on Seinfeld, Maggie Biederhof on HBO's Mildred Pierce, many roles on the various Law & Order shows, and Dr. Serova on Star Trek, TNG.

Josh Lewis - Sol Josh Lewis is an actor, writer, and director. His work in TV includes: extensive writing and performing with Comedy Central and MTV, appearances on many New York based TV shows including Law & Order and Late Night with Conan O’Brien. Josh was an original cast member and Co-writer of Crepuscule, which evolved into the Tony Award winning 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ee. He has acted, directed and written for countless New York theater companies, including: the Atlantic Theater Company, Manhattan Theater Club, Naked Angels, and The 52nd Street Project.

Lorraine Farris - Dr. Marcy Veteran actress Lorraine Farris made her screen debut as, Pinky in the cult classic Natural Born Killers directed by Oliver Stone. She then went on to work with Mary Harron in I Shot Andy Warhol playing Susan Pile. Her extensive TV credits include Sex And The City, Law & Order: SVU, Person of Interest and The Slap.

Michael Warner - Uncle Dave Michael Warner is most notable for his role as Oliver Spence in House of Cards (Netflix). Michael has numerous theatre credits including Engaging ShawI (Old Globe), Wings (Second Stage), the world premier of Lucy Thurber’s Monstrosity (13P), Missed Connections (ARS NOVA) as well as shows at the prestigious Roundabout, The Atlantic, Soho Rep among others. He has had multiple appearances on Law & Order, As The World Turns, Boardwalk Empire, All my Children, Breaking Upwards.
